This new series of linear encoders brings to the market the worldûs smallest magnetic signal period of 40um with full industry standard referencing options.
The lineup of three models provides measuring lengths from 70 to 2040mm with a choice of accuracy grades of +/-3 or +/-5um.
The available output signals are 1V peak-peak sinusoidal based on 40um signal period or TLL (EIA422) with resolution steps 0.05 to 1um.
The referencing options are single, multiple and distance coded.
The scale dimensions and installation method provide close compatibility with other popular feedback linear encoders reducing the need for OEMs to make design changes to their machines.
The new technologies include high-density magnetic coating technique of the grating, DLC (diamond like carbon) coating material of the MR reading head and MR sensing pattern cancelling temperature drift and high harmonic frequency.
An intelligent microprocessor circuit in the encoder reading head eliminates the need for any trimmers or user adjustment of the output signals.
The SR34 model, with direct 0.1um resolution TTL output, has real-time autocompensation circuit of the DC, gain and phase.
The incorporation of all these new technologies result in an interpolation error of less than 0.3um and speed capability of 150m/min.
Under test conditions the introduction of condensation, normally found in the machine tool environment, resulted in no deterioration of the interpolation error.
Although designed to meet a wide range of machine applications the SR33/34 will initially be marketed at the grinding machine sector where the accuracy performance combined with resistance to the effects of condensation are the features most sought after.
